What companies run services between La Thuile, Italy and Rome, Italy?

You can take a vehicle from La Thuile to Roma Termini via Bourg St Maurice, Chambery Challes Les Eaux, and Milano Centrale in around 10h 29m. Alternatively, Sellitto operates a bus from Courmayeur to Roma, Autostazione Tiburtina twice a week. Tickets cost €55–70 and the journey takes 10h 42m.
